How To Fix ENHANCEMENT217 - Filter value & violates namespace convention of table &


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: ENHANCEMENT - SAP customer enhancement project messages

  • Message number: 217

  • Message text: Filter value & violates namespace convention of table &

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message ENHANCEMENT217 - Filter value & violates namespace convention of table & ?

    The SAP error message "ENHANCEMENT217 Filter value & violates namespace convention of table &" typically occurs when there is an issue with the filter value being used in an enhancement or modification related to a specific table. This error is often associated with the use of namespaces in SAP, which are used to avoid naming conflicts between different development objects.

    Cause:

    1. Namespace Violation: The error indicates that the filter value being used does not conform to the naming conventions defined for the specific table. In SAP, namespaces are used to categorize objects and ensure that they do not conflict with standard SAP objects or other custom developments.
    2. Incorrect Filter Value: The filter value may contain invalid characters or may not follow the expected format for the specific table.
    3. Enhancement Implementation: If you are implementing an enhancement or modification, the filter value may not be correctly defined or may not be compatible with the existing data structure.

    Solution:

    1. Check Filter Value: Review the filter value being used in the enhancement. Ensure that it adheres to the naming conventions and does not contain any invalid characters.
    2. Namespace Compliance: Verify that the filter value is compliant with the namespace conventions for the specific table. If you are using a custom namespace, ensure that it is correctly defined.
    3. Review Enhancement Implementation: If you are working with an enhancement implementation, check the code and logic to ensure that the filter value is being set correctly and is compatible with the table structure.
    4. Consult Documentation: Refer to the SAP documentation or the specific enhancement documentation for guidance on the correct usage of filter values and naming conventions.
    5. Debugging: If necessary, use debugging tools to trace the execution and identify where the violation occurs. This can help pinpoint the exact cause of the error.
